ESP-IDF环境配置
时间: 2023-10-09 07:09:23 浏览: 307
你好!关于ESP-IDF环境配置,以下是一些基本的步骤:
1. 首先,你需要安装Python 3.8或更高版本,并确保将其添加到系统的环境变量中。
2. 下载ESP-IDF:你可以从ESP32官方GitHub页面下载最新的ESP-IDF版本。选择与你的操作系统兼容的压缩文件,并解压到一个合适的位置。
3. 运行环境设置脚本:在ESP-IDF目录中,运行`./install.sh`(Linux/macOS)或`install.bat`(Windows),以设置所需的环境变量和工具链。
4. 安装所需的工具:ESP-IDF需要一些额外的工具支持,如CMake、Ninja、git等。确保这些工具都已经安装并配置好。
5. 配置ESP-IDF:运行`idf.py set-target <target>`命令,选择你的目标设备,并设置其它配置选项。
6. 测试安装:使用`idf.py --version`命令,检查ESP-IDF是否成功安装。
这些是基本的步骤来配置ESP-IDF环境。但请注意,具体步骤可能因你使用的操作系统和ESP-IDF版本而有所不同。记得查阅ESP-IDF文档以获取更详细的配置说明和示例。祝你成功配置ESP-IDF环境!如果还有其他问题,请随时提问。
相关问题
esp-idf环境配置 vscode
在使用VSCode配置ESP-IDF环境时,有几个步骤需要遵循。
首先,需要下载并安装VSCode软件。然后,在VSCode中下载并安装Espressif IDF插件。这一步只需下载插件,不需要进行任何配置。接下来,需要下载ESP-IDF工具。可以在终端中运行以下命令来下载ESP-IDF工具:
```
mkdir -p ~/esp
cd ~/esp
git clone --recursive https://github.com/espressif/esp-idf.git
```
在下载完成后,需要进行工具的配置。在终端中运行以下命令:
```
cd ~/esp/esp-idf
./install.sh
```
然后,需要设置环境变量。同样在终端中运行以下命令:
```
cd ~/esp/esp-idf
./export.sh
```
为了方便使用,可以在`~/.bashrc`文件中添加一个宏命令。打开`~/.bashrc`文件,可以使用以下命令:
```
vi ~/.bashrc
```
在文件的最后一行添加以下命令:
```
alias get_idf='. $HOME/esp/esp-idf/export.sh'
```
保存文件后,每次打开一个新的终端窗口,只需要输入`get_idf`命令,就可以给对应的终端窗口添加ESP-IDF的环境变量。
最后,可以创建自己的工程并开始开发。希望这些步骤能够帮助您成功配置ESP-IDF环境并在VSCode中进行开发。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[ESP-IDF/VSCode安装和使用(ESP32开发环境)](https://blog.csdn.net/luhanhua/article/details/131028184)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
- *2* *3* [ESP-IDF + Vscode ESP32 开发环境搭建以及开发入门](https://blog.csdn.net/qq_43332314/article/details/129015602)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
vscode配置esp-idf环境
要在 VS Code 中配置 ESP-IDF 环境,需要完成以下步骤:
1. 安装 VS Code:如果您还没有安装 VS Code,可以从官网下载并安装。
2. 安装 ESP-IDF:首先,您需要从官网下载 ESP-IDF 并解压缩到您的本地目录。然后,您需要设置 IDF_PATH 环境变量,以便 VS Code 可以找到 ESP-IDF。在 Windows 上,您可以按照以下步骤设置环境变量:
- 右键单击“计算机”或“此电脑”,然后选择“属性”。
- 点击“高级系统设置”。
- 在“系统属性”对话框中,选择“环境变量”。
- 在“环境变量”对话框中,选择“新建”。
- 输入“IDF_PATH”作为变量名,并将 ESP-IDF 的路径作为变量值。
3. 安装 CMake:在 VS Code 中使用 ESP-IDF,需要使用 CMake。在 Windows 上,您可以从官网下载并安装 CMake。
4. 安装 ESP-IDF 扩展:打开 VS Code,然后在左侧的扩展菜单中搜索“ESP-IDF”。找到扩展后,点击安装并等待安装完成。
5. 配置 VS Code:在 VS Code 中,您需要打开您的 ESP-IDF 项目文件夹。然后,您需要打开“命令面板”(Ctrl+Shift+P),并搜索“ESP-IDF: Configure ESP-IDF”。按下回车键后,您需要选择 ESP-IDF 的路径和串口端口。
完成以上步骤后,您就可以在 VS Code 中使用 ESP-IDF 开发您的项目了。
阅读全文